Funny you ask. Just getting ready to post. I love it. I put mine on myself sans lathe. I used a REALLLY sharp kiradashi knife to trim excess then various sandpapers to finish. This thing really amp'd up the ball speed. Had a hard leather on before and this WDU is much better. Easy to chalk(a lot better than phenolic or g10) and breaks with pretty good control. Does have a sorta plastic/metallic sound but not as bad as a phenolic. So far(about a week) i'm diggin' it. BTW, where do you play in T-Town? I've been using my Sonic tip / Mezz break cue with a red circle cue ball, and I really don't see any damage it's doing to the ball - red circles easily have the most durable surface of the quality cue balls I've used.
I also feel the Sonic tip just feels too hard and doesn't hold chalk well, although I've never miscued when breaking with it. I'm thinking of trying either an Outsville Hammerhead tip or a Samsara break tip. I have two break shafts, so I think I may try one on each, and see which I like better.
